Texas Audubon had to close its Sabal Palm Sanctuary temporarily in May. They had hoped to reopen it by mid-October, but unfortunately that cannot be so.

The Nature Conservancy's Lennox Foundation Southmost Preserve
The Rio Grande Valley Birding Festival trips scheduled to visit Sabal Palm will instead visit The Nature Conservancy’s Lennox Foundation Southmost Preserve [Southmost]. Southmost is located just east of Sabal Palm, not even a mile away, and has very similar habitats and birds. This jewel is normally closed to birders and the public, but we have made special arrangements for Festival-goers to be able to visit this preserve.
Both properties have well deserved reputations, with Southmost a well-kept “secret” among the locals here in South Texas. We regret the necessity of moving this trip, but we are sure that you will enjoy the rare opportunity to visit TNC’s “Secret” Southmost Preserve!
